While most Broadway shows offer a ticket lottery or general rush, there are some shows that specifically offer student rush, which requires a college or high school student ID for purchase.

Off-Broadway is particularly kind to students. Because shows have shorter runs, these policies are more often developed by the home theatres (Atlantic Theatre Company, 59E59, Brooklyn Academy of Music, Irish Repertory Theatre, etc.) than by the shows. (That means more opportunity for cheap tickets!) The average ticket for an Off-Broadway show is $20 per person; that鈥檚 cheaper than a movie and popcorn.
If you want access to consistent deals for Broadway, Off-Broadway, Off-Off-Broadway, and concerts, consider purchasing a TDF membership. The Theatre Development Fund is a non-profit service organization for the performing arts whose mission includes making theatre accessible to more people鈥攖hat means lower ticket prices. You can save up to 70 percent on tickets for in-advance purchases. Full-time students are eligible for the membership. While membership costs $35 per year, the savings on a single Broadway ticket make it worth the price. .
